Making his mark with 1999’s debut Brand New Second Hand, Roots Manuva’s classic gravelly Jamaican flow has never been matched and his complex subject matter and use of language has developed across albums Run Come Save Me, Awfully Deep, Slime & Reason and a number of dub interpretations and remixes of those albums. He has been a mainstay of NZ radio with tunes like Witness (One Hope), Collossal Insight and Let The Spirit dominating both airwaves and clubs still to this day.

His new album is a freshly minted classic. 4everevolution is intense, cutting and clever. Monster tracks such as ‘Watch Me Dance’ are grown up club bangers and is widely believed to be his best album to date. Mr Underatted keeps on delivering — here’s to another decade for the king of gangster pet shop boys.

The good news is that Roots Manuva will be bringing a full live band, setting venues ablaze with five studio albums’ worth of material and giving NZ audiences the first bite of the new tracks live.
